The Department of Fisheries, Kargil successfully conducted a one-day outreach program for fish farmers at the newly constructed office of the Assistant Director, Fisheries in Kharool, Kargil on May 27. The event focused on the National Fisheries Digital Platform (NFDP) and was held under the Pradhan Mantri Matsya Kisan Samridhi Sah-Yojana (PMMKSSY).

Executive Councilor for Tourism and Fisheries, Kacho Mohammad Feroz, attended the event as the Chief Guest. He was joined by Councilor Ranbirpora, Abdul Wahid, Councilor Bhimbat, Abdul Samad, and Mohammad Amin Lone, Assistant Director of Fisheries, Kargil.

In his address, EC Feroz highlighted the growing potential of the fisheries sector in Kargil, calling it a "booming industry" that offers significant opportunities for economic growth. He stressed the need to raise public awareness about fish farming and its benefits, noting its increasing popularity among locals.

Assistant Director Mohd Amin Lone provided an overview of the National Fisheries Digital Platform (NFDP), explaining that it offers several key benefits to fish farmers, including registration, credit facilitation, aquaculture insurance, performance-based grants, traceability, training, and capacity building. “The NFDP is a game-changer for the fisheries sector,” he said, urging all stakeholders to register and take advantage of the platform under PMMKSSY.

The attending Councilors also addressed the gathering, reaffirming their support for fish farmers and encouraging wider adoption of fish farming practices.

During the program, the Councilors distributed essential fishing equipment, including trout pelleted feed, fish covering nets, digital dissolved oxygen (DO) meters, fish handling nets, and rechargeable torches to the farmers.

The Department of Fisheries announced plans to continue such outreach programs and camps across the district to promote NFDP registrations and expand access to benefits under PMMKSSY.
